Fred aka Cari Lekebusch - Fred 2 (reissue)

Cari Lekebusch is an enigmatic figure but was a key early player in the Swedish techno scene with a big say in the wider evolution of European techno. 'Fred 2' is one of his most sought after records from those early years and this reissue features three massive tunes written back in 1993. The EP opens with the deep and funky techno rhythms of stone cold classic 'Nightshade', before 'Prototype' brings a trippier vibe with manic synths darting around a booming kick. The 10 minute behemoth 'Mono Flight' closes out the record with a lesson in classic dance floor hypnosis, its swirling layers gradually building and growing over deep and throbbing bass. Three cuts that very much make their mark, even three decades on.

Blue Vision - Machines Will Transform Us EP

Phosphor returns with its fifth release and a new chapter for the label’s founders, Blue Vision. As their second EP on the imprint, Machines Will Transform Us (PHP005) confirms the project’s direction: a precise balance between club-driven tech house and more immersive, hypnotic electro textures.

Across the EP, Blue Vision asks a simple question: after spending our days connected to algorithms and modern machines, can repetitive rhythms and mechanical grooves on the dancefloor turn us into machines once again, or instead help us reconnect with ourselves?

Machines Will Transform Us (A1) opens the EP with a driving Italo bassline and tight, tech-driven drums. Melodic 80s synths contrast with sharper electro elements, gradually building tension before a final drop designed for peak-time impact. The track sets the tone for the release: machines transform us as much as we transform them.

Then comes Just a Game (A2), blending spacious 90s progressive and synthwave influences over a rock-solid club bassline and crisp drums. Playing with atmosphere and emotion, the track explores the feeling that we are never too far from a simulation, that maybe everything is just a game. Perfectly suited for introspective yet intense moments, it acts as an ideal bridge between harder tracks in a set.

On the flip side, I Love Acid (B1) is direct, hypnotic, and designed to lock the dancefloor into a steady flow. Stripped back to punchy drums and a raw acid line, it takes a minimal approach that works equally well in early hours or late-night sets. Behind the title lies the idea of acid as both machine energy and mental escape, where repetitive sequences blur the boundary between human emotion and mechanical movement.

As a final touch, Scan Your Brain (B2) shifts into deeper, more immersive territory. Analog pad textures create a drifting atmosphere over a hypnotic bassline and electro drums. With this closing track, Blue Vision answers their initial question by imagining the dancefloor as a space to disconnect from rigid thinking. The vocal serves as a reminder that the brain is constantly overloaded, and that dancing becomes a way to let go, reset, and reconnect.

Holo - Thunder EP

Holo

Thunder EP

12inchHSM016
Houseum Records
07.08.2026

With his distinctive touch for melody and texture, "Thunder EP" opens a portal to a new world, both vibrant and underground. Split into two parts, the A-side burns with a groovy house and breakbeat energy, while the B-side shines with deep, progressive and electronic soundscapes.

With its powerful vocals reminiscent of Bicep and a melody that brings a breath of fresh air, the opening track of the EP "Thunder" has all the makings of a future anthem. It perfectly sets the tone with its raw breakbeat energy and rolling textures

Right after, the A2 "You've Got The Feeling" offers a subtle blend of softness and groove. True to Houseum’s deep and sunny DNA, the track revolves around an effective classic piano house hook and a captivating soul vocal that instantly sticks in your head.

Closing the A-side, "Space Jam" shifts into more atmospheric territories with floating vocals and airy synth pads, moving the dancefloor toward a deeper, more mental vibe.

On the flip side, the hypnotic bassline of the B1 "Bullet Train" sets the pace immediately. The track nods to 90s progressive house through its structure while offering distinctive deep tech and dub techno sounds.

Finally, "Haag" wraps up the record with a subtle blend of IDM, ambient, and dub techno, a sound aesthetic that might remind a certain In Limbo EP released on Houseum's sub-label, Ellipse Records. It acts as the perfect closing track, inviting the listener to wind down and float away after the intensity of the previous tracks.

Giacomo was digging through Discogs when he came across a mysterious Len Lewis release — three untitled tracks, no trace of it anywhere nor audio clips, only the cat# LJL003. He ordered the only copy and got in touch with Len shortly after, who to quote said "it's like listening to someone else's music."

The distribution company folded before they could see the light, and it turned out the records had only ever reached the test pressing stage in 2002. 

Now, for the first time, these tracks are being officially released!

Second Circle returns with a reissue of ‘Rainsong’ by Gus Till, presented here alongside a new remix from Japanese producer Kuniyuki Takahashi.

Originally emerging from Melbourne’s post-punk and new wave underground in the late 1970s and early 1980s, Gus Till has spent more than four decades navigating a remarkably diverse musical path. From early electronic experimentation with Third Eye alongside Ollie Olsen, through a pivotal role in the formative years of the global psy-trance movement and collaborations with artists including Michael Hutchence, System 7, Manu Dibango, Todd Terry and Bim Sherman, Till’s work has consistently resisted easy categorisation, moving fluidly between ambient music, downtempo, house, trance and psychedelic electronica.

First released on Japan’s Dakini Records in 2006, ‘Rainsong’ captures many of these threads in a single expansive composition. Built around a pulsating bassline, layered live percussion and soaring vocal elements, the track sits comfortably between the dancefloor and more immersive listening environments. Unfolding patiently across nearly thirteen minutes, it combines hypnotic rhythmic momentum with a rich sense of atmosphere and musicality.

For the B-side, Kuniyuki Takahashi offers a distinct reinterpretation of the original. His remix gradually unfolds from a patient introduction into a deep and richly textured exploration of the track’s core themes. Subtle spatial processing, nuanced arrangement shifts and his unmistakable sense of atmosphere transform the source material while preserving its emotional core.

LA MARR - MOOD PROGRAMS - EXTENDED PLAY

Music From Memory presents 'Mood Programs – Extended Play', a two-track release by LA MARR, a new project conceived by Ron Trent. Representing the first in an ongoing series of releases on Music From Memory, ‘Mood Programs - Extended Play’ opens a new chapter within Trent’s deep and continually evolving body of work, rooted in mood-driven composition, spatial depth and the emotional resonance of sound within physical space.

Influenced by ambient and environmental music, New Age, dub traditions, New Wave, Krautrock and HiFi sound system culture, LA MARR reflects many of the formative ideas that informed Trent’s evolving approach to sound and sonic architecture from the early 1980s onward. Rather than revisiting these influences nostalgically, the project recontextualises them through a contemporary production language, balancing analog warmth with precision and spatial depth.

Developed through years of sonic experimentation and research into the physical and psychological qualities of sound, LA MARR extends Ron Trent’s long-standing interest in the relationship between rhythm, acoustics and human connection. Built through a combination of analog processes and contemporary computer-assisted production, the project explores warmth, resonance, depth and sonic clarity through carefully sculpted environments of tone and texture.

Gently unfolding within a spacious, ambient-leaning framework, 'Mood Programs – Extended Play' moves beyond passive background listening toward something more intentional and immersive. Across both tracks, ‘Good Magic’ and ‘Clear’, layers of hypnotic synthesizer arpeggios and gently floating pads gradually unfold alongside organic percussion and subtle low-end movement, creating compositions that feel simultaneously meditative, physical and emotionally responsive. Sound is treated not simply as musical information, but as an environmental force capable of shaping perception, mood and awareness within a room.

Mr K - Edits-Golden/Umi Says

The talented Mr. K continues to build up the most comprehensive collection of DJ essentials to hit the 7-inch format with this latest offering of two beloved classics from the golden era of neo soul. First up is Jill Scott’s self-empowerment anthem ‘Golden’, here the original version stitched together with an unreleased 2005 breakdown remix by London crew Blackbeard. Using sweeping strings from the Blackbeard version, dramatically building to a tambourine acapella & original track makes for a masterful edit, one even more impressive when it’s done as seamlessly as this. The flip side ups the tempo with Mos Def’s ‘Umi Says’, a unique hybrid of broken drums, swirling keyboards (courtesy Weldon Irvine Jr. and Will.I.Am!), a propulsive bassline, and those instantly addictive vocals. Mr. K adds a solid minute of intro, giving the song the room it deserves to breathe, and just lets things simmer without distraction. Another masterclass at the edit board, and another gem to add to our growing treasure trove of work from Mr. Krivit in maximum sonic fidelity both for their first appearance in a 7-inch format.

SOULDYNAMIC - EQUATORIALE

Souldynamic celebrates the 10th year anniversary of their all time classic “Equatoriale” with two special re-edited and re-mastered versions, including an instrumental mix and released on vinyl format only on Excedo Records.

“Equatoriale” became Souldynamic's biggest track after the release of the legendary video showing Lil Louis playing it at Concrete in Paris with the acapella of Chuck Roberts - My House.

The 12 inch record also includes two more fresh new tracks which make this record perfect for the summer heat.
